Giovanni Di Lorenzo’s agent, Mario Giuffredi, confirms Inter, Juventus, Roma and Atletico Madrid inquired about the Italy defender who decided to stay at Napoli mostly thanks to Antonio Conte: ‘He was fundamental.’

Di Lorenzo pushed to leave Napoli before EURO 2024 after hearing that the club would listen to offers for him.

“When Manna said he’d have considered offers, Giovanni started to think that he wanted to leave,” the defender’s agent Giuffredi said at a press conference on Monday.

“Put yourself in the player’s shoes. He did 99 good things and a bad one and was treated this way. Morally, it was so bad.

“Inter were the first club to call,” the defender’s representative continued.

“You [journalists] fueled speculations about Juventus, but Inter were the first to inquire because Dumfries has a year left in his contract, so they asked for information.

“Juventus, Inter, Roma and Atletico Madrid called me recently. They were interested in Di Lorenzo, but we reached an agreement because he wanted to stay at Napoli.”

The appointment of Conte was surely a turning point for the Partenopei’s captain.

“He arrived and he listened to us. During a meeting, I said for one hour that we wanted to go, but Conte put himself into our shoes and understood a player who had had any sort of issue in the previous season. He listened to us and proved that he wanted us to stay. He was fundamental because he worked with us to solve all problems when we met.”
